Bobcat
|
|
Genus
|
Felis
|
|
Species
|
rufus
|
|
Subspecies
|
escuinapae
|
|
Status
|
Endangered
|
|
Distribution
|
Deserts of the American southwest; forests of North America; Southern Canada to Mexico
|
|
Length
|
28-50 inches (71-127 cm)
|
|
Weight
|
13-68 pounds (6-30 kg)
|
|
Behavior
|
The bobcat is most active at night, when it hunts for food.
|
|
Diet
|
Its favorite meal is rabbit.
|
|
Feeding
|
The bobcat is a nocturnal creature that hunts for its food at night. It prefers to hunt alone.
|
|
Conservation
|
The bobcat's beautiful fur makes it a target for hunters. This animal also suffers severely from habitat loss, as cities and farms spread into wilderness areas. |
